Understanding Liquid Staking on Sui

Liquid staking protocols enable users to stake their cryptocurrency assets and receive derivative tokens in return. These derivatives represent the staked assets and can be used across various decentralized applications (dApps), providing liquidity while earning staking rewards. The Sui blockchain, known for its high throughput and low latency, presents an ideal environment for liquid staking solutions to flourish.

Compared to more established networks like Ethereum and Solana, Sui's liquid staking market is still in its early发展阶段. Currently, only about 2% of staked SUI tokens possess liquidity, significantly lower than Ethereum's 30.5% and Solana's 10.1%. This substantial gap indicates tremendous growth potential for liquid staking protocols operating within the Sui ecosystem.

Haedal Protocol's Innovative Approach

Haedal Protocol addresses several limitations in the current Sui staking landscape through its innovative Hae3 framework, which consists of three core components:

Dynamic Validator Selection

Unlike traditional staking protocols that use static validator assignments, Haedal implements a dynamic validator selection mechanism. The protocol continuously monitors all network validators, automatically staking assets with nodes offering the highest Annual Percentage Rate (APR). When unstaking is required, the system prioritizes withdrawal from validators with lower APRs, ensuring consistently competitive yields for users.

HMM (Haedal Market Maker)

The protocol's integrated market maker solution enhances liquidity across Sui-based decentralized exchanges. By combining oracle pricing with real-time market data, HMM optimizes trading efficiency while generating protocol revenue through a 0.04% transaction fee. From February to March, trading volume grew from $59.13 million to $284.15 million, generating $236,000 in fees with an average TVL of $800,000.

HaeVault for Simplified Yield Farming

HaeVault simplifies liquidity provision for users with idle funds, eliminating the complex management typically associated with LP positions. The platform employs an ultra-narrow rebalancing strategy that has demonstrated remarkable yield optimization. For example, while Cetus offered a 250.8% APR on the SUI-USDC pair, HaeVault achieved an impressive 1,117% APR, maintaining a net yield of 938% after deducting protocol fees.

Token Utility and Governance

The native HAEDAL token provides holders with multiple benefits, including governance rights through veToken locking mechanisms and yield boost capabilities within HaeVault. The token's design encourages long-term participation while distributing protocol benefits to committed stakeholders.
